  • As we embrace the power of solar energy, it’s crucial to talk about the dark side of connectivity! A recent report highlights that a staggering 35,000 solar power systems are currently exposed to the internet, making them prime targets for cyberattacks. This vulnerability not only threatens the integrity of our renewable energy sources but also raises serious concerns about data privacy and grid security. As electrical engineers, we must prioritize cybersecurity in our designs and advocate for stronger protections in renewable technologies.
